The Director Business Engagement & Governance builds and leads a team focused on ensuring Information Technology (IT) delivers the right solutions at the right time with measurable business outcomes. This role establishes governance practices manages the IT project portfolio oversees vendor and contract value realization and ensures software licensing is properly managed. The Director Business Engagement & Governance serves as the bridge between business leaders and IT driving transparency prioritization and accountability across all technology initiatives.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ities |
- Establish and maintain IT governance frameworks and operating models to ensure consistent decision-making and accountability.
- Lead the IT portfolio management process including intake prioritization planning and resource allocation.
- Drive transparency and communication between IT and business stakeholders on project status value risks and timelines.
- Ensure technology initiatives align to strategic objectives and deliver measurable business value.
- Partner with business leaders to define requirements outcomes and success metrics for key initiatives.
- Manage vendor performance contract value realization and ensure vendors deliver agreed outcomes and service levels.
- Oversee software licensing management compliance and optimization across the organization.
- Facilitate cross-functional decision-making and resolve conflicts to keep projects on track.
- Implement and track benefits realization for major IT initiatives ensuring value is captured and measured.
- Travel required 50% of time to company facilities and key business locations for stakeholder engagement team collaboration and project delivery.
